Sometimes even the most precious things in our life are taken for granted by us. We never think of what we would feel if they are suddenly taken away from us, what their loss would mean to us. A sudden announcement of being deprived of our language which we thought was ours, a realisation that it is the last time we would use it leaves us stunned. This is what the ' The Last Lesson ' highlights. The people of Alsace never gave much importance to their mother tongue. They did not insist that their children should give it whole- hearted attention. They did not encourage regular attendance of their children in the french class. They preferred their children to work and earn rather than learn. An order from Berlin to ban French and make German compulsory made them realise the importance of their mother tongue.They came in full force to attempt Mr. Hamel 's last lesson. The title is therefore justified as the last lesson in French is highly significant and is the central theme of the story. It shows the awakening of people to the importance of their mother tongue when it is going to be taught for the last time.
